Neighborhood Overview – Douglas Byrd High School
Douglas Byrd High School is situated in a well-established area of Fayetteville, offering a blend of residential neighborhoods and accessible commercial zones. The school is conveniently located near major thoroughfares, making travel to and from the campus straightforward. Interstate 95, a primary north-south route, is a short drive away, providing access to other parts of North Carolina and beyond. US Highway 401 also runs nearby, connecting Fayetteville to Raleigh. Parking directly at the school can be busy on event days, so understanding the campus layout and designated areas is key for efficient arrival. The nearest major airport serving Fayetteville is Fayetteville Regional Airport (FAY), which is approximately a 15-20 minute drive from the school, depending on traffic. For those arriving from further afield, Raleigh-Durham International Airport (RDU) is about a 1.5 to 2-hour drive north. Public transportation options in Fayetteville are somewhat limited, making personal vehicles or rideshare services the most common methods for getting around. Planning to arrive at least 30-45 minutes before any scheduled event is advisable to account for potential traffic congestion around the school and to allow ample time for parking and check-in procedures.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Temperatures in winter typically range from the low 30s to the mid-50s Fahrenheit. Days are often crisp and cool, requiring layers such as jackets or sweaters. Outdoor events are manageable but can be chilly, especially in the mornings and evenings; hats and gloves are recommended. Be prepared for potential frost or very light rain, but significant snow is rare.
Spring & early summer
Expect mild to warm temperatures, usually between the 60s and 80s Fahrenheit, with increasing humidity as summer approaches. This is a prime season for outdoor sports. Lightweight clothing like t-shirts and shorts are comfortable, but a light jacket or hoodie might be useful for cooler evenings. Be aware of occasional spring showers that can pass through quickly.
Mid-summer
Summers are hot and humid, with temperatures frequently in the 80s and 90s Fahrenheit, often feeling hotter due to humidity. Lightweight, breathable fabrics are essential. Staying hydrated is paramount for anyone participating in or attending outdoor events. Early morning or late afternoon games are often scheduled to avoid the peak heat. Sunscreen and hats are highly recommended.
Fall season
Fall brings a welcome change with comfortable temperatures, generally ranging from the 50s to 70s Fahrenheit. Humidity decreases, making it ideal for outdoor competitions and spectating. You’ll likely need long sleeves or light layers, as mornings and evenings can be cool. This is a beautiful season in Fayetteville, with changing foliage contributing to pleasant outdoor experiences.
Rain & snow
Rain is possible year-round, but more frequent in the summer months as thunderstorms. Heavy rain can impact outdoor fields, potentially leading to delays or cancellations; check with event organizers for protocols. Snow is infrequent and usually light, melting quickly. When snow does occur, it can cause travel disruptions due to unfamiliarity with driving conditions.
